Two suspects seen stealing city trash cans on South Meridian St, Indianapolis IN
At the 1400 block of South Meridian Street, a white male in a blue hoodie and a possible white female were seen stealing city trash cans and walking northbound. It is unclear if the trash cans belonged to the caller or others.
